Mattie Emaline Barton, 90, of El Dorado, Arkansas, passed away Friday, April 2, 2010 at Hudson Memorial Nursing Home. Born September 18, 1919, in Mineral Wells, TX, she was the daughter of the late David Albert Mays and Henrietta Gillespie Mays. She was a homemaker, a member of Green Grove Assembly of God and a Bible scholar. She enjoyed crocheting, quilting and gospel singing.

Preceding her in death are her parents; her husband, Merton Wayne Barton; three brothers, D.A. Mays, Johnnie Mays & J.C. Mays; two sisters, Fannie Boland, Ruth McMillian and three great-grandsons, Ethan Scott Barton, Aaron Isaiah Barton and Ruston Lee Greer.

Survivors include two sons, Danny Barton and his wife Carol of Crossett, Gary Barton and his wife Carol of El Dorado; two daughters, Renetta Greer and her husband Ralph of Hector, Winna Adams and her husband Jimmy of El Dorado; a brother Harrell Mays of Friona, Texas; a sister, Winnie Tucker of Mexia, Texas; eleven grandchildren; eighteen great-grandchildren and three great-great grandchildren.
